Safety

Car seats are designed to ensure your baby is safe and a quality one should have some extra features beyond the safety standards set by the federal government. They include padded inserts for the head and shoulders and air-repellent fabrics to keep them cool while driving in hot weather.

The ease of installation and use of the seat is another important aspect to consider for safety. Ideally, you should be in a position to snap it in place with minimum effort and with clear indicators that it's secure in its place, level, and placed properly.

There are many features that aid in this process like belt guides and built-in locks to help you align the car seat with your car's seatbelt. Avoid buying used car seats that may not have been tested for crash or have been involved in an accident. They could not protect your child. If you have to buy an used car seat ensure that it has an expiration and that the seller isn't an individual who does not have proof of ownership.

Another thing to keep in mind is to only leave your infant in the car seat for up to two hours per day, unless they are lying down in a supine position. This will help prevent strain on the spine of your child and ensure they are able to breath regularly.

Design

Car seat designs are as varied as the vehicles they're placed in. While some parents opt to not use infant car seats to opt for convertible models, the majority of new moms want something that will grow with their baby into toddlerhood. The most flexible choice is an all-in-one infant car seat, which allows you to change between forward-facing and rear-facing. It typically has a higher weight and height limit and can also be used as a booster when your child is old enough.
